    Nick Freund - Closing a Startup

    Nick Freund - Closing a Startup

    This wasn't the interview I expected to do. I thought I'd interview Nick Freund about his startup, Workstream. Between the time we scheduled our podcast and when we hit the record button, he shut down his company. That's a pretty major shift, to say the least.



    What's it like to shut down a company? Nick discusses the various pivots of his startup, trying to raise capital in a brutal funding environment, the data tooling landscape, the process of shutting down a company, and much more.



    This is an emotional episode, and I'm glad we got the opportunity to make it happen. I feel like stories like Nick's are all too common, yet rarely vocalized in the brutally honest way that Nick describes his story.
